Bimini is a miniscule 7-mile long island just 50 miles off the coast of Miami. It is relatively unknown to most, shadowed by its more trendy Bahamian neighbors such Nassau and Paradise Island which boasts the enormous Atlantis resort. But those looking for something slightly undiscovered yet coaxed with luxury and authenticity, will do well by checking Bimini instead.
Getting There Is Half The Fun | South Florida residents can start the adventure via Tropical Airways, an airline whose mere name will get you in the vacation spirit. Board the 8 passenger seaplane and fly low above the ocean before landing right on the gorgeous Resorts World Bimini property. Seeking a more conventional flight service" Silver Airways launched flights this summer from Tampa & West Palm Beach, and perhaps most notably, Elite Airways launched a new nonstop flight from Newark to Bimini, making it the first time New York City area travelers can travel direct without having to stop to connect in Miami or Fort Lauderdale.
